Add Silverware's analog aux channel feature to Bayang protocol (#215)
* Expanded Bayang protocol to have Option 2, which adds two analog auxiliary channels driven by channels 14 and 15. The expert byte is taken over, as is the extra txid byte, which is not used by Silverware. * Change Bayang options - Bit 0 (LSB) enables telemetry and Bit 1 selects analog aux channels * Changed Bayang protocol bind to ensure binding only when telemetry and analog aux option selections match on RX and TX * Add details for Bayang protocol update
